git pull origin masterを実行すると、gitリポジトリのフォルダー内のファイルが更新されないようです。
3 に答える
1
いくつかの提案、
git pull -v origin master冗長バージョンが手がかりを生み出すかどうかを確認してみてください。
リポジトリのクローンを作成して、前の状態にすることができる場合git pull:
- 行ったgitpullが変更を導入したかどうかを確認します:
current = `git rev-parseHEAD`
git pull origin
git diff$current.。
- を試してください
git fetch origin master。これは、 「」ではなく「」と同等です(つまり、' 'ブランチまたはリモートトラッキング' 'ブランチではなく、' 'ブランチ(リモート' 'の)のフェッチされた値を格納します。 つまり、そのフェッチによって変更が導入されるかどうかを試行して検出できます。git fetch origin master:git fetch origin master:mastermasteroriginFETCH_HEADmasterremotes/origin/master
git diff ... FETCH_HEAD
于 2010-04-14T01:21:12.720 に答える
0
あなたはグレムリンをハズすることができます。
git-pullリモートの変更を取得し、それらを現在のブランチにマージすることになっています。
変更がマージされたことgit logを確認するには、必要なリビジョンがローカル ブランチにあることを確認します。
docogit-pullより:
次に、リモート ブランチを現在のブランチにマージします。
$ git pull origin next
于 2010-04-13T23:33:42.533 に答える
0
リモートに変更を加えていない可能性があります (または、リモートを維持している人が更新していません)。
おそらく、複数のリモコンを持っていて、どれpullがフォームを取得するのか混乱しているかもしれません.
于 2010-04-14T02:02:20.827 に答える